Indulge in the Unique Strawberry and Matcha Afternoon Tea at Royal Park Hotel

Experience a Luxurious Strawberry and Matcha Afternoon Tea at Royal Park Hotel



Beginning February 15, 2026, the Royal Park Hotel in Nihonbashi, Tokyo, invites guests to relish a limited-time Strawberry and Matcha Afternoon Tea at its 1F Lobby Lounge, Fontaine. Serving delectable treats until March 31, 2026, this afternoon tea promises a delightful experience for both dessert and savory lovers, highlighting the beautiful balance between western and Japanese flavors.

A Unique Blend of Flavors


The Strawberry and Matcha Afternoon Tea aims to showcase the elegance of strawberries combined with the rich depth of matcha. One of the standout dishes is the charming chocolate sculpture illustrating a bear standing in a strawberry field, elegantly crafted in a delightful “strawberry milk” hue, adorning a bouquet of flowers. Guests will also be treated to a striking glass dessert featuring matcha sponge layered with mascarpone cream and strawberry jam, topped with fluffy whipped cream.

Alongside these treats are a variety of enticing desserts, including two-tone macarons in pink and green, an opera cake infused with matcha and white chocolate, and a rich chocolate terrine explicitly designed to exalt the flavor of matcha. The colorful menu also includes a refreshing rosé sparkling wine jelly paired with strawberry compote and tarts combining matcha chocolate cream with strawberries.

Savory Selections


To round out the experience, guests can indulge in a range of savory offerings. The appetizers feature a harmonious blend of jamón serrano with cottage cheese, delicately accented with strawberry and matcha aromas. The menu also includes a unique tea soba inari, drizzled with a sweet and savory sauce reminiscent of mitarashi, and deep-fried fish with a tartar sauce containing matcha and noble shiba-zuke pickles, bringing a touch of Japanese sensibility to the afternoon tea experience.

Afternoon Tea Overview


  • - Period: February 15 (Sunday) – March 31 (Tuesday), 2026
  • - Time: 11:00 AM to 5:00 PM
  • - Location: 1F Lobby Lounge, Fontaine
  • - Price: ¥8,000 per person
  • - Reservation / Inquiry: Call 03-5641-3600
(Reservations available from 9:00 AM to 7:00 PM)

Menu Highlights


1. Upper Tier: Chocolate sculpture, strawberry and matcha tiramisu, strawberry and matcha macarons.
2. Middle Tier: Rosé sparkling wine jelly with strawberry compote, matcha opera cake, matcha chocolate terrine, strawberry and matcha chocolate tart.
3. Lower Tier: Jamón, strawberries, and cottage cheese (with matcha sauce), tea soba inari, fish fry served with matcha and shiba-zuke tartar sauce.
4. Additional Plates: Vegetable potage, matcha affogato, and two types of scones (plain & strawberry with white chocolate chips). Accompanied with clotted cream, strawberry jam, and apricot jam.
5. Beverages: The set includes 17 varieties of free-flowing drinks including premium teas from Smicks Tea.

All prices are inclusive of tax and service fees; please note that menu items may vary.

About Royal Park Hotel


Established in 1989, Royal Park Hotel is a full-service hotel in Nihonbashi, Tokyo, reputed for its high-quality service catering to a diverse range of customer needs. The hotel represents a modern interpretation of traditional hospitality, characterized by elegance and refinement, welcoming guests with unique offerings.

Located at: 2-1-1 Kakigaracho, Chuo-ku, Tokyo
Room count: 419
Facilities: Includes a restaurant, bar, event hall, tea room, chapel, shopping arcade, hair and beauty salons, relaxation salon, photography studio, and a beautiful Japanese garden.
